JOB DETAIL

Responsibilities

·      Lead multi-year technology-related programs with cross-divisional impact, applying deep expertise within a given discipline. Ensures that the scope of the project is defined to align with business priorities and that business value is delivered per agreed upon plan.

·      Plan the work and monitor progress and results documenting tasks throughout the project to ensure all tasks, deliverables, and project materials are delivered promptly.

·      Run agile ceremonies per defined cadences with project team.

·      Submits regular status reports to management and internal and external stakeholders and presents status as required.

·      Communicate with stakeholders, leaders, team members, management, and department partners to ensure that requirements and priorities are understood.

·      Build and maintain relationships across program stakeholders and proactively fosters effective communication between internal and external parties. Drive key decisions to ensure alignment with overarching goals across stakeholders.

·      Ensure all steps are taken to mitigate risk and maintain control, compliance, audit, and legal requirements on technology projects. Maintains an appropriate level of technical and business knowledge to support program implementation.

Qualifications:

·      Minimum of 10 years of technical project management experience required.

·      PMP certification

·      Scrum master certification preferred.

·      Cloud Native experience (A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ud Platform).

·      Cybersecurity and network infrastructure experience.
